Output 3758b9925edd0b733648b71848aa10c4122303c39b6beb8b3a81ed4a64108040:0

value
22870765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ad18a1d533e50d4a3cd42bc38ce71ec515c662ed OP_EQUAL
address
MPgQe68e4cNNJ2ZxmMFQBbUaCP1oKjy72o
transaction
3758b9925edd0b733648b71848aa10c4122303c39b6beb8b3a81ed4a64108040
spent
true